    Responsibilities

    · Perform unclaimed property work of considerable difficulty in the area of claim processing.

    · Investigate exercising some individual judgment.

    · Independently while exercising an elevated level of prudence and discretion.

    · Facilitate the Section's statutory requirement to safeguard the property in its custody.

    · Validate and substantiate the claims of ownership of unclaimed property.

    · Process unclaimed property claims using the precise application of program rules, regulations, policies and procedures, the laws affecting ownership (such as domestic relations and probate) for all 50 states, federal regulations and international restrictions.
